O'Meara, Lawrence 'Larry'
Lawrence “Larry” O'Meara, 60, of 309 First St., Colesburg, died 2 p.m. Friday, March 16, 2012, at his home in Colesburg. Friends and relatives of Larry may call from 3 to 8 p.m. Monday at Reiff Funeral Home in Farley, where a wake service will be held at 4 p.m., the Farley American Legion Auxiliary will meet in a body at 6:45 p.m. and the Farley American Legion and New Vienna VFW service will be held at 7 p.m. Services for Larry will be held at 10:30 a.m. Tuesday, March 20, at St. Joseph's Catholic Church in Farley, with the Rev. Dennis Cain officiating. Burial will be held at St. Joseph's Cemetery in Farley, with full military honors afforded by the Farley American Legion Post 656 and New Vienna VFW Post 7736.
Larry was born Feb. 15, 1952, in Oelwein, Iowa, son of Jim Konzen and Lois O'Meara. He received his education at St. Joseph's School in Farley and graduated from Western Dubuque High School in Epworth. On Oct. 15, 1971, he was united in marriage to Patricia “Patty” Elliott at St. Joseph's Catholic Church in Farley. He was an Army veteran, having served from 1971 to 1991; during his career he served in Fort Leonardwood, Mo., Fort Hood, Texas, and at the Pentagon, as well as six years in Germany and five years in Italy. After retiring from the service he was employed with the City of Colesburg; before that he was employed at Exide in Manchester and also worked as a handyman.
He was a member of the Farley American Legion Post 656 and the New Vienna VFW Post 7736.
He is survived by his wife, Pat O'Meara of Colesburg; two children, Lori O'Meara of Chehalis, Wash., and Matt (Cindy) O'Meara of Center Point; five grandchildren, Taylor and Kaitlin Hutchinson, Kyrstin Froehle, Jenna and Megan O'Meara; one great-grandchild, Peyton Hutchinson; five siblings, Jerry (Lynn) Konzen of Farley, Ray (Millie) Konzen of Albuquerque, N.M., Steve “Matt” Konzen of Farley, Judy (Dave) Trenkamp of Farley, Jane (Kenny) Bolsinger of Colesburg; and brothers- and sisters-in-law, Michael (Vi) Elliott of Dubuque and Mary Beth Elliott of Dubuque.
He was preceded in death by his father, James Konzen.
A Lawrence O'Meara Memorial Fund has been established.
